Technical Superiority: Design Parameters, Material Quality, and Manufacturing Standards

The technical differentiation of 868 and 656 wire fences lies in key specifications that decisively impact performance and application suitability. For instance, the 868 type employs double horizontal 8mm wires and a single vertical 6mm wire, enhancing rigidity and structural integrity. In contrast, 656 models use dual 6mm horizontal wires with a 5mm vertical, optimizing for lighter-weight installations without substantially compromising on strength.

A significant proportion—estimated at 62%—of users now seek fences with minimum tensile strengths of 450 MPa and maximum mesh panel deflection of less than 10mm under standardized impact load. This rising demand for high durability is met by selecting low-carbon steel (Q195/Q235), advanced Galfan coatings (Zn-Al alloy), and multilayer powder coatings—increasing fence lifespan by up to 40% compared to conventional systems. Moreover, precision welding at cross points and anti-UV treatment ensure the panels maintain both function and appearance for a decade or longer.

Technical Comparison: 868 vs 656 Wire Fence
Specification 868 Wire Fence 656 Wire Fence
Wire Diameter (Horizontal/Vertical) 8mm/6mm 6mm/5mm
Panel Height (Standard) 1.8–2.4m 1.5–2.0m
Panel Width 2.5–3.0m 2.0–2.5m
Mesh Size 200 × 50mm 200 × 50mm
Surface Finish Zinc + Powder Coated Galvanized / Powder Coated
Tensile Strength > 450 MPa > 400 MPa
Approx. Weight (per panel) 25–30 kg 18–22 kg

These specifications are aligned with EN 10223-7 and other global standards, guaranteeing compliance for both public and private sector projects.

Supplier Insights: Sourcing, Quality Control, and Logistics

Partnering with reputable 868 and 656 wire fence suppliers minimizes procurement risk and streamlines project timelines. The supplier ecosystem is defined by factors such as product consistency, on-time delivery, and after-sales support. In a 2022 survey across 50 construction companies, over 78% shortlisted suppliers based on real-time quality tracking, defect rates below 1.5%, and flexible logistics arrangements.

Comprehensive supplier vetting often includes third-party audits, in-house tensile and coating tests, and ability to provide technical documentation such as Mill Test Certificates (MTCs) and Material Safety Data Sheets (MSDS). Logistics proficiency, especially regarding container optimization and transit insurance, further distinguishes top suppliers. Professional suppliers also facilitate seamless customs clearance with harmonized tariff codes (HS Code: 73144900) and offer batch-based shipment for phased project executions.

Modern procurement trends favor prioritizing suppliers who also provide digital inventory management, real-time order tracking, and technical consulting to optimize fence selection and deployment.

FAQS on 868 and 656 wire fence

Q: What are 868 and 656 wire fences?

A: 868 and 656 wire fences refer to double wire mesh fence systems distinguished by the diameter of their horizontal and vertical wires. The 868 type uses two 8mm horizontal and one 6mm vertical wire, whereas the 656 uses two 6mm and one 5mm wires. Both types are known for their strength and security.
